Analyze Current Operations
To kick off your efficiency journey, take a close look at your current operations. This involves dissecting every process and workflow to identify bottlenecks or redundancies. Gather data on how work flows through different teams. Are tasks being completed promptly? Which areas seem sluggish? Use tools like flowcharts or performance metrics to visualize the entire operation. Engage with employees—they often have insights that can reveal hidden inefficiencies. Their day-to-day experiences provide valuable feedback about what’s working and what isn’t.
Embrace Technology
Technology is no longer optional for businesses aiming for efficiency. It’s an essential tool that transforms operations and drives productivity. Start by identifying areas where technology can make a difference. Automation software, for example, can handle repetitive tasks efficiently. This frees up your team to focus on more strategic work. Cloud-based solutions enhance collaboration among teams. They allow real-time access to documents from anywhere, promoting flexibility and responsiveness. Investing in data analytics tools provides invaluable insights into customer behavior and market trends.
Optimize Resource Allocation
Efficient resource allocation is the backbone of any successful business. It’s about placing people, time, and money where they’ll create the most impact. Start by assessing your current resources. Identify underutilized assets or team members who could contribute more effectively in different roles. This analysis can reveal hidden potential. Next, prioritize projects based on their importance and expected return. Not everything deserves equal attention; focus on initiatives that align with your long-term goals.
Streamline Communication
Clear communication is the backbone of any efficient business operation. When team members understand their roles and expectations, tasks get done faster. Consider implementing collaboration tools. Platforms like Slack or Microsoft Teams can facilitate instant messaging and file sharing. This reduces email clutter while keeping everyone on the same page. Regular check-ins are also essential. Short stand-up meetings allow teams to discuss progress and address challenges quickly. These interactions foster a sense of unity and accountability.
